Originally Posted by 40love
Brilliant thanks that makes a lot of sense. GE is quicker to type than Elite though

So was it Jade - Gold - Gold Elite?
Gold Elite is the old name of Elite. Jade is also no longer used.
Member -> Silver -> Gold -> Elite
And out of flow is Elite Priority One (EP1)

Here's a question: do the bonus points meet the "metal" requirement: in my case, towards the 668? Or only towards the 798?
To retain Elite status, you need to earn a further 798 Status Points in the 12 months from your tier anniversary. At least 668 of these must be earned on Air New Zealand Operated flights or qualifying partner airline flights.
